主要内容

mustBeFolder

验证输入路径是否指向文件夹

    描述

    例子

    mustBeFolder (路径抛出一个错误路径不指向文件夹。这个函数不返回值。

    mustBeFolder调用以下函数以确定输入是否指向文件夹

    类支持:所有金宝appMATLAB®

    例子

    全部折叠

    使用mustBeFolder函数,以确保传递给函数的文件夹路径是有效的文件夹,并避免使用条件语句在函数体中测试有效的文件夹。

    runInFolder函数确保在更改到该文件夹以运行函数之前指定的文件夹是有效的。

    函数r = runInFolder(路径)参数路径{mustBeFolder}结束orgFolder = cd(路径);r = myFunct;cd (orgFolder)结束

    在输入时传递无效的文件夹名会导致错误。

    r = runInFolder (“myFunct.m”);
    在位置1使用runInFolder无效参数时出错。以下文件夹不存在:'myFunct.m'。

    输入参数

    全部折叠

    指定为字符串标量、字符向量、字符串数组或字符向量的单元格数组的一个或多个文件夹的路径。

    例子:“H: \ myfolder \ mysubfolder”

    数据类型:字符|字符串

    提示

    • mustBeFolder用于属性和函数参数验证。

    介绍了R2020b